Applications
The PIC16F15356T suits embedded control applications in home appliances, industrial sensors, and HVAC systems where 8-bit processing with rich on-chip peripherals eliminates external components. Its 4x PWM outputs, 12-bit DAC, and dual EUSART interfaces make it ideal for motor speed control, sensor interfacing, and protocol bridging in battery-powered or low-voltage 2.3 V minimum systems.

Frequently Asked Questions
What memory and clock specifications does PIC16F15356T-I/SS offer for embedded designs?
The PIC16F15356T provides 28 KB Flash program memory, 2 KB RAM, and a maximum clock frequency of 32 MHz, enabling efficient execution of real-time control algorithms. It also operates at 2.3 V minimum supply at 16 MHz, making it suitable for battery-powered embedded applications.
How do the 4x PWM outputs and 12-bit DAC of PIC16F15356T-I/SS benefit motor and lighting control designs?
The 4 independent PWM channels allow simultaneous control of multiple motor phases or LED drivers, while the 12-bit DAC provides high-resolution analog output for reference voltage generation. Combined with the 32 MHz clock and 28 KB Flash, this makes PIC16F15356T capable of closed-loop motor speed or brightness control without external DAC ICs.
Which communication interfaces does PIC16F15356T-I/SS support for sensor and display connectivity?
The PIC16F15356T integrates 2 EUSART channels, SPI, and I2C interfaces, supporting up to 4 simultaneous serial connections in the 28-pin SSOP package. This enables concurrent sensor data acquisition via I2C, display control via SPI, and bidirectional host communication via EUSART in a single 8-bit microcontroller running at 32 MHz.
